RMIT Digital Media presents Extremely Online, a digital showcase that launches tomorrow and runs June 3-6, 2021. Free and completely online at extremelyonline.rmitdigitalmedia.com, it will include digital and interactive works alongside live performances.

We are lucky to have guest artists similarobjects and Bridget Chappell participating. They will both be showcasing AV works alongside interactive, digital and performative pieces by students and alumni.

similarobjects is a Filipino experimental sound artist, producer and composer who will be presenting their last ever AV piece under that moniker, a 30 minute AV performance called ‘Solipsism'.

Bridget Chappell is an organiser and artist, known for their work with Melbourne Sound School and as Hextape amongst much more, who will contribute a new AV work.

Both works will be presented as part of a livestream performance program from 6:30pm AEST on Friday June 4, alongside jemisahologram aka Lauren Abineri, an early-career multidisciplinary artist from RMIT Digital Media whose practice includes music and sound-based interventions, solo and collaborative.

Extremely Online is curated, organised and produced by the Curating the Digital studio. The studio of 27 participants took on the challenge of staging an online digital event for the program this semester. The ongoing impact of the pandemic has limited face to face events and despite hardships for many, this has contributed to an increasingly diverse ecology of online events. Curating the Digital studio seeks to participate in this space through Extremely Online, in the hope of connecting people and providing a creative platform for the RMIT Digital Media community. Those of us in Victoria find ourselves in lockdown as we ready to launch the event, as many have experienced around the world over the last year, and this makes our work all the more vital.
